I've had the same issue the past days. How I got past it was by modifying the download url, where I'm guessing for you it said "codec=AAX_22_32" . Try putting instead "AAX_44_128" or "LC_128_44100_Stereo". Trying those gives me ep7 quality. Just "AAX" gives 62kb" and anything random (eg "t") gives you the old .aa files.

I don't know much about the issue you're running into, but those are not srt subs. That's just pgs with a different extension. To make srt subs, extract the pgs as .sup, load them in SubEdit, and ocr them
